    Abstract: A ground site for a building is prepared for construction of a portland cement concrete slab-on-grade (PCC SoG). Using a computerized weather application, weather conditions for a geographic locale that includes the ground site are monitored to identify a window-of-time during which the weather application indicates there is a less than 50% chance of precipitation at the geographic locale. The surface of the ground site is proof rolled during the window-of-time. Using concrete emplacement equipment during the window-of-time and only after the ground site passes proof rolling, wet concrete is emplaced on the ground site to a nominal thickness that does not exceed 7 inches and that is at least one inch less than a PCC SoG design for the ground site having a design thickness based on design guidelines set forth by the American Concrete Institute. Emplacing must be completed with at least 4 hours remaining in the window-of-time.

    Abstract: A floating screed device has a first section for cutting through plastic concrete and a second section for floating on the plastic concrete. The two sections are pivotally coupled for rotational movement about a pivot point. Elevation of the second section is measured and used to rotate the first section as the floating screed device is moved through a volume of the plastic concrete that is unfinished. As a result, the second section pitches to follow the first section.

    Abstract: A floating screed device includes: an elongated float, rigid and spaced-apart rods with the tops thereof defining a planar region having a planar bottom for floating on plastic concrete, a device coupled to the float to determine elevation thereof relative to a target elevation in the plastic concrete, and a support and adjustment (S/A) mechanism that moves the rods based on the elevation so-determined as the floating screed device is moved through a volume of the plastic concrete that is unfinished. In general, the rods are moved by the S/A mechanism such that the planar region defined by the rods rotates about an axis that is parallel to the rods and per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of the float.

    Abstract: A form for concrete strike-off has a rigid straightedge assembly and a support coupled to one end of the straightedge assembly. The straightedge assembly includes a grate coupled to the bottom edge of a support bar. The grate extends away from the support bar with a top surface of the grate defining a plane on at least one side of the support bar. In use, a portion of the straightedge assembly defines a reference elevation for concrete strike-off operations.

    Abstract: A system is provided for the collection of measurements for use by a surface profiling processing scheme. A movable platform is equipped to: (i) generate a measurement of inclination of a surface when the platform is and stationary thereon, (ii) generate measurements of surface curvature as the platform traverses the surface, (iii) monitor distance that the platform traverses during a measurement run, (iv) generate a signal each time the platform traverses a predetermined amount of distance during a measurement run where the signal is such that the user is alerted to stop the platform, (v) collect measurements of curvature while the platform traverses the surface, and (vi) collect measurements of inclination at the starting position, stopping position, and each time the platform is stopped during the measurement run.

    Abstract: A movable platform is provided for use with a surface profiling system. The platform eliminates all errors associated with wheel inconsistencies. A frame is supported above a surface by, among other supports, three supports arranged in a linear alignment that defines a direction of travel for the frame. The three supports are defined by a front support, a rear support and a center support centered between the front support and rear support. The center support is a floating support capable of substantially vertical movement. At least two of the front support, rear support and center support are wheels configured to roll in the direction of travel defined by the three supports that are linearly aligned. These wheels are coupled to one another for synchronizing rolling movement thereof on the surface.

    Abstract: A joint insert is provided as well as a system and method for using same in the finishing of a surface's joint. The joint insert is a strip of material having a central longitudinal axis dividing the strip into first and second halves that are mirror-images about the central longitudinal axis. The strip is folded along the central longitudinal axis so that when the strip is positioned in the joint, the strip's central longitudinal axis and portions of the strip's first and second halves extend out of the joint. Gaps are formed between the joint and portions of the strip within the confines of the joint. A filler material is used to fill the gaps. As a final step in the finishing process, any of the strip and filler material extending above the plane of the surface over the joint is removed.
